Cultural promotions are making waves in the crypto realm, especially among younger traders. The impact of celebrity endorsements and exclusive community access is shaping how these traders buy, sell, and hold digital coins. Let’s break down how these trends influence novice investors and what it might mean for their financial futures.
Cultural promotions have a unique pull in the world of crypto trading. They often tap into social identity, creating a sense of belonging and exclusivity. This feeling of being part of a unique community can push individuals towards financial decisions that carry inherent risks. Young investors, particularly, are keen to cement their identity in a fast-paced market where every move is scrutinized.
When it comes to virtual currency trading, celebrity endorsements can’t be ignored. A star backing a cryptocurrency or trading platform can lend instant credibility. The result? A surge in interest as FOMO kicks in. With younger generations, especially Gen Z, this psychological trigger is powerful, as they rush to seize perceived opportunities before they evaporate.
Social media is a double-edged sword for young traders. It spreads information like wildfire and stirs excitement through influencers, creating a breeding ground for impulsive trading. As these young enthusiasts scroll through their feeds, they encounter success stories and endorsements that can lead to snap investments, all driven by a desire to fit into a community celebrating trading wins.

However, the pitfalls of these promotions shouldn’t be overlooked. The gamblification of trading platforms can muddle the waters between investing and gambling. Features like instant rewards and competitive environments can lead to hasty trading decisions, encouraging excessive trading and losses. This culture of gamblification may erode financial literacy, with young traders favoring short-term gains over savvy strategies.
